Kinds of Doors and WindowsTypes of Doors
Doors can be found in different styles, each meeting specific requirements and preferences. Here are a few of the most typical types:
Hinged Doors: Traditional doors that swing open and closed on hinges. These can be interior or exterior doors.Sliding Doors: Doors that move along a track, often used for patio area gain access to and providing a modern-day appearance.Bi-fold Doors: Made up of several hinged panels that fold against one another. Suitable for large openings to develop an open home.French Doors: Often utilized as outdoor patio doors, they consist of two panels that swing open, allowing lots of light and a clear view of the outdoors.Pocket Doors: A sliding door that vanishes into a wall cavity, conserving area where a swinging door might be unwise.Garage Doors: Available in various styles, consisting of roller, sectional, and tilt-up alternatives, working as the entryway to garages.Types of Windows
Windows likewise are available in numerous styles and products, each offering unique benefits. Secret types include:
Double-Hung Windows: Traditional windows with 2 operable sashes that slide up and down.Casement Windows: Windows that are depended upon one side and open outward, enabling for maximum ventilation.Awning Windows: Similar to casement windows but hinged at the top, opening outside and perfect for rainy environments.Picture Windows: Fixed windows that supply extensive views without the ability to open.Bay and Bow Windows: Protruding windows that create additional interior space, typically discovered in living spaces.Skylights: Installed in roofing systems to allow natural light into upper levels of homes or structures.Materials for Doors and Windows
The products utilized in windows and doors considerably impact their resilience, maintenance needs, and insulation homes. Typical materials include:
MaterialDescriptionProsConsWoodTraditional option, offered in different designsVisually pleasing, excellent insulatorRequires routine upkeep, prone to rotVinylMade from PVC, versatile and low-maintenanceEnergy-efficient, resistant to moistureMinimal designs compared to woodAluminumLight-weight and strongDurable, corrosion-resistantPoor insulator without thermal breaksFiberglassComposite material, can mimic woodHighly durable, energy-efficientMore expensive in advanceSteelStrong and safe and secureFire-resistant, ideal for securityProne to rust if not properly treatedAdvantages of Doors and WindowsSecurity

Energy Efficiency
Energy-efficient windows and doors can significantly lower heating and cooling expenses. Functions like double-glazing, low-E finishes, and adequate insulation minimize energy consumption, leading to lower utility costs.

Setup and Maintenance
Appropriate setup and routine upkeep of windows and doors are crucial for optimizing their durability and functionality.
Installation StepsStep: Accurate measurements guarantee a best fit.Select Materials: Consider sturdiness, style, and energy performance.Prepare the Opening: Ensure the structural integrity of the surrounding structure.Position the Door/Window: Set the system within the ready opening, making sure level and plumb alignment.Secure in Place: Use screws and brackets to attach securely.Insulate and Seal: Apply weather-stripping and caulk to avoid air leaks.Finish: Install any extra trims and complete the interior/exterior surfaces.Maintenance TipsRegular Cleaning: Clean glass surfaces with suitable cleaners to preserve clarity.Inspect Seals: Regularly look for gaps in seals and weather condition removing.Lube Hardware: Keep hinges, locks, and sliding elements well-lubricated to prevent rust and guarantee smooth operation.Look for Damage: Look for indications of rot, rust, or disrepair, and address them immediately.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
